National Association of Sports Commissions 20th Anniversary


The National Association of Sports Commissions (NASC) is turning 20 this year! David Clark, Director of Business Development at Meetingmax attended the NASC annual Symposium in Hartford, Connecticut to celebrate.

Today is the final day of the symposium which took place from April 16-19th this year, giving guests the opportunity to learn more about bidding and hosting sports events successfully. This occasion also gave everyone a chance to network, make connections and meet the competition!

David found the event both informative and entertaining. One session that stood out was “working with third party housing organizations”; the overall feeling of the conversation was that many destinations are getting away from using 3rd parties and turning their focus on empowering the destination to act as it’s own housing organization. Big thanks to Peter Harvey from Buffalo Sports Commission who discussed in detail why it makes more sense for destinations to become their own housing organization than to utilize a third party.
